General Electric In Capitulation: Time To Buy

Monday's 50% dividend cut by General Electric (NYSE:GE) was like a one two knock out punch for beaten down investors long the stock. The much awaited investor conference left some with more questions than answers about the company and the path forward.

As one long the stock, I am just plain disgusted with outgoing CEO Jeffrey Immelt's leadership at the helm of this 125 year old conglomerate. The fact that he misguided the street in regards to earnings by the inflating future EPS by 100% is just plain ridiculous; frankly I don't blame investors for fleeing the stock.
